Bad Bunny's Return and a Potential Showdown
The wrestling world is abuzz with the potential return of Bad Bunny to WWE. But here's where it gets controversial: rumors suggest he might face Logan Paul upon his comeback. This has sparked debates among fans, with some questioning the legitimacy of such a match-up. WWE-affiliated sources, including podcast host Sam Roberts and insider Andrew Baydala, are fueling the speculation. But will this highly anticipated return live up to the hype?
WrestleMania Blackout: A Strategic Move?
In a surprising turn of events, distributors near Las Vegas' Allegiant Stadium have been instructed not to show WrestleMania 42. WWE remains tight-lipped, but sources claim it's a strategic move to boost ticket sales. Could this blackout be a clever marketing tactic, or is there more to the story?
The Return of Dominik Mysterio and David Finlay's Future
Fightful reports that Dominik Mysterio is expected to return to the ring soon, much to the delight of his fans. Additionally, WWE insiders have discussed the potential signing of David Finlay, former IWGP Global champion. His younger brother's recent prominence in NXT might be a hint at WWE's plans for David. But will he join the WWE roster, or is there another promotion in his future?
Finlay's Dual Contract and Samoa Joe's Injury
New Japan Pro Wrestling fans were shocked by David Finlay's apparent farewell this week. However, a previous SelfMade report suggests he might sign a dual contract, primarily working for AEW while making occasional returns to Japan. Meanwhile, Fightful Select confirms Samoa Joe's injury in AEW's concussion protocol, but details remain scarce. Andrade has stepped in to fill the void, and company officials are thrilled with the fan response.
